Texas! Sage – Sandra Brown – 1*
Oh, dear. I love a steamy Texas romance, and Brown delivers the steam. But the plot is ridiculous, and the characters are cardboard cutouts. The sex was okay, if unrealistic. And I actually liked Harlan Boyd as the “outsider” who wins the girl. I have read later books by Brown and really liked them, so don’t let this one completely deter you from her work.

Charlotte Illes Is Not a Detective – Kate Siegel – 1*
Former child detective is asked by her brother and his girlfriend to solve a missing person case. The premise sounded cute for a cozy mystery, but I just never got into this book. What should have been a fast, entertaining read, turned into a drudge that took me more than a month to read. By the time the case was solved I had ceased to care.

The Village Library Demon-Hunting Society – C M Waggoner – 1*
Waggoner seemed to throw every idea she had at the wall, hoping something would stick. It sounded like it might be a fun, slightly different, kind of cozy, however, the result was dreadful. The plot was thin, the character development completely lacking. I finished only because it fit a specific challenge.
